ProgressBarの回転アニメーションをカスタマイズする
弟もプロジェクトで見たことがありますが、もともと接触したことがないので、今の実現方法を簡単に書いてください.
手順1:res/animフォルダの下でprogress_などのアニメーションを定義します.bar_anim.xml
ステップ2:ProgressBarを定義する場所で、このアニメーションを呼び出す
これで実現できます.
手順1:res/animフォルダの下でprogress_などのアニメーションを定義します.bar_anim.xml
<?xml version="1.0" encoding="UTF-8"?>
<animation-list android:oneshot="false"
xmlns:android="http://schemas.android.com/apk/res/android">
<item android:drawable="@drawable/loading01" android:duration="100" />
<item android:drawable="@drawable/loading02" android:duration="100" />
<item android:drawable="@drawable/loading03" android:duration="100" />
<item android:drawable="@drawable/loading04" android:duration="100" />
<item android:drawable="@drawable/loading05" android:duration="100" />
<item android:drawable="@drawable/loading06" android:duration="100" />
<item android:drawable="@drawable/loading07" android:duration="100" />
<item android:drawable="@drawable/loading08" android:duration="100" />
<item android:drawable="@drawable/loading09" android:duration="100" />
<item android:drawable="@drawable/loading10" android:duration="100" />
</animation-list>
ステップ2:ProgressBarを定義する場所で、このアニメーションを呼び出す
<ProgressBar
android:id="@+id/searching_pb"
android:layout_width="30dp"
android:layout_height="30dp"
android:indeterminate="false"
android:indeterminateDrawable="@anim/progress_bar_anim"
/>
これで実現できます.